In 2020, Third Man Records released a compilation album that rediscovers the shoegaze acts of Detroit in the 90s. Now, the follow-up album, Southeast of Saturn Vol. 2 has been released. This time, music from Midwestern groups beyond Michigan are being revisited. The compilation includes groups spanning Ohio, Illinois, Indiana, Wisconsin, and Minnesota. Jill recently had a conversation with Rich Hanson, a shoegaze fanatic who contributed to both compilations. Hanson credits Minnesotan bands Colfax Abbey and Shapeshifter for exposing him to the shoegaze scene of the Twin Cities. Third Man describes Southeast of Saturn Vol. 2 as cementing the Midwest’s status as a breeding ground for the space-rock and shoegaze subgenres.

 

Shoegaze is a subgenre of indie and alternative rock characterized by its ethereal mixture of obscured vocals, guitar distortion and effects, feedback, and overwhelming volume. The name comes from the heavy use of effects pedals, as the performers were often looking down at their pedals during concerts. Most artists in the genre drew inspiration from My Bloody Valentine on their late 1980s recordings, as well as bands such as Dinosaur Jr., The Jesus and Mary Chain, and Cocteau Twins. Early 90s shoegaze was pushed aside by the American grunge movement and early Britpop acts, but we’ll be bringing it back this morning.
